IT has long been a hotspot for Southampton residents wanting to idle away a few hours by the River Itchen at Mansbridge.
In despite of this Mansbridge once had a terrible reputation as a traffic bottleneck as cars, lorries and vans all squeezed their way over the river on the old stone bridge that once carried the busy A27.
This photograph was taken on September 27,1952, around the time when workmen took the plunge in sturdy waders to strengthen the river bank,weakened by water erosion,with wood and concrete and also make the waterside path safe from collapse.
